The IKM-Manning Community School District earned “commendable” ratings for all three of its attendance centers in the 2025 Iowa School Performance Report. Looking at districtwide proficiency scores, IKM-Manning students significantly outpaced the state averages in math, science, and English language arts. Grade-level math proficiency for the Wolves was 82.66 percent, compared to the 70.93 percent average for Iowa students. Science proficiency measured 75.8 percent, eight percentage points higher than the average. English language arts proficiency reached 77.7 percent, about four points higher than Iowa’s average. IKM-Manning also performed well in graduation rates, both for four-year and five-year, at 95.92 percent and 98.04 percent, respectively. Very few students at IKM-Manning are considered chronically absent, with just 6.68 percent, which is well below Iowa’s average of 15.81 percent. With all three attendance centers earning a commendable rating from the Iowa Department of Education, IKM-Manning will not need additional support or observation from the state in the coming year.
